DeKalb woman arrested after road-rage incidents and high-speed chase

DEKALB, Ill. (WIFR) – A DeKalb woman is charged on Tuesday after multiple road-rage incidents and a chase with deputies, according to reports.

Kara L Hale, 38, is charged with aggravated fleeing to elude, reckless driving and numerous other traffic violations.

Feb. 17, DeKalb County Sheriff’s deputies went out to a call of a woman causing a disturbance in the area of Glidden and Wolf Roads in Kingston.

Callers reported a woman was yelling at passing cars, exiting her car and running into traffic. Deputies searched the area and couldn’t find the suspect…
